Runbook: Replica lag alarm (Duskwater DB)

If your plugin triggers the read-replica lag alarm, first check whether your queries bypass the Cinderpath query router — direct replica reads are the usual culprit. Lag over 30 seconds pauses plugin read traffic automatically; it resumes once the replica catches up. Thresholds and pause behavior are controlled by the settings that follow.

config for bahop-fajep:
DRUATH_PIN=4501
DRUATH_TENANT=briwyn
DRUATH_METRICS_HOST=metrics.druath.brasksoft.test
DRUATH_SEAL=seal_7d2e069d
DRUATH_STANDBY_TEAM=olieth

## Local Setup

Welcome to the Framewhip transcode farm! Clone the repo, run `make bootstrap`, and start the worker with `./farmctl up`. Jobs won't pick up until the scheduler can reach the metadata store, so make sure Postgres is running locally first. Point your worker at the jobs database using the connection string below.

primary connection of tawif-yajeg = postgresql://rusiel_svc:G879q9cx6GsSvj@db-dd9f.norvagrid.internal:5432/casath

## v2.8.0 — WebSocket compression tradeoffs

We enabled permessage-deflate on the Brightquill relay, but only for payloads over 2 KB. Smaller frames cost more CPU to compress than the bandwidth saved, and the context-takeover memory per connection adds up fast at our concurrency levels. New team members: read the benchmark notes before changing thresholds. Compression is disabled entirely on the mobile tier pending heap profiling. Questions about this decision should go to the engineer named below.

account owner for bawif-yawip: Ralmir Wenmir